What to Expect from an Atlanta Car Accident Attorney

When you hire an Atlanta car accident attorney, you can expect them to provide comprehensive legal representation throughout the entire process. Here are some of the key things to expect from your attorney:

Initial consultation

The first step in working with an Atlanta car accident attorney is usually an initial consultation. During this meeting, you will have the opportunity to discuss the details of your accident and injuries with the attorney. They will ask you questions about the accident, review any evidence you have, and provide you with an overview of how they can help you. This initial consultation is typically free, and it’s a great opportunity to get a sense of whether the attorney is a good fit for your needs.

Case evaluation and strategy

After the initial consultation, the attorney will evaluate your case and develop a strategy for pursuing compensation. This may include gathering additional evidence, consulting with experts, and negotiating with insurance companies.

Filing a lawsuit

In some cases, it may be necessary to file a lawsuit in order to pursue compensation for your injuries. If this is the case, your Atlanta car accident attorney will file the lawsuit on your behalf and represent you in court.

Settlement negotiation or trial

Most car accident cases are settled out of court, but in some cases, it may be necessary to go to trial to obtain a fair settlement. Your attorney will negotiate with the insurance company on your behalf and will fight to ensure that you receive the compensation you deserve.

Tips for finding an Atlanta car accident attorney

Ask for recommendations

Ask for recommendations from family, friends, or coworkers who have gone through a similar experience. They may be able to recommend an attorney who they had a positive experience with and who provided excellent legal representation.

Research online

There are many resources available online that can help you find an Atlanta car accident attorney. Look for attorneys who specialize in car accident cases and who have positive reviews from previous clients. You can also check their website for information about their experience, qualifications, and areas of expertise.

Check with the State Bar of Georgia

The State Bar of Georgia website maintains a directory of licensed attorneys in the state, which can be a useful resource for finding an Atlanta car accident attorney. You can search by location and area of practice to find attorneys who specialize in car accident cases.

Schedule a consultation

Once you’ve found a few potential attorneys, schedule a consultation with each one. During the consultation, you can ask questions about their experience, qualifications, and approach to handling car accident cases. This will give you a sense of whether they are a good fit for your needs.

Consider their fee structure

Car accident attorneys typically work on a contingency fee basis. They only get paid if you receive compensation. Before hiring an attorney, make sure you understand their fee structure and any other costs associated with working with them.

Frequently Asked Questions

What kind of compensation can I receive after a car accident

The compensation you may be entitled to after a car accident in Atlanta can vary depending on the circumstances of the accident. Some common types of compensation include medical expenses, lost wages, property damage, and pain and suffering.

How long do I have to file a car accident claim in Atlanta?

The statute of limitations for personal injury claims, including car accident claims, is two years from the date of the accident. late filling may lead to loss of your right to compensation.

Do I need to hire an attorney if the other driver’s insurance company is offering a settlement?

In addition it is always a good idea to consult with an attorney before accepting a settlement from an insurance company. The attorney can review the settlement offer and ensure that it is fair and covers all of your expenses related to the accident.

How much does it cost to hire an Atlanta car accident attorney?

Most car accident attorneys in Atlanta work on a contingency fee basis, which means that they only get paid if you receive compensation.

The fee is a percentage of the total compensation you receive, and is agreed upon before the attorney begins working on your case.

What should I do if I can’t afford to pay for a car accident attorney?

Many car accident attorneys in Atlanta offer free consultations. Some may be willing to work on a pro bono or reduced-fee basis for clients who cannot afford to pay. Be sure to ask about the attorney’s fee structure during your consultation.
